Re: Any Social workers out there - even better if ontario based.
Yes! Before you commence with your job search you must have your qualifications evaluated by the Canadian Association of SW; then pending that, register with the Ontario College of SW and SSW, then register with the OASW - of course you will know all this! It is unlawful to call yourself a Social Worker in Ontario, unless you are registered with the OCSWSSW (similar to the GSCC). Depending when you qualified, you may have to take an additional module at Ryerson University; Masters in Social Work is valued more for internationally trained Social Workers; not sure about DipSW.
